web-dev-qa-db-fra.com

1and1 Domain et Heroku - Trop de redirections

J'ai une application hébergée sur Heroku, Domain et DNS. La cible est <appname>.herokuapp.com, comme d'habitude.

Mon domaine 1and1 <domain>.net est configuré pour une redirection HTTP vers www.<domain>.net. J'ai ajouté le sous-domaine www qui contient l'alias CNAME <appname>.herokuapp.com.

Cela devrait fonctionner, au moins j'ai lu sur cette "solution de contournement" dans plusieurs discussions sur Stackoverflow/Webmasters.

Cependant, accéder à <domain>.net ou à www.<domain>.net entraîne une erreur "Trop de redirections".

Il n'y a pas de fichiers .htaccess sur tout l'espace Web 1and1 associé, si cela compte. L'application Heroku est écrite dans Node.js et fonctionne correctement lorsque vous y accédez via le domaine Heroku. Comment puis-je résoudre ça?

Edit:

Ce sont les paramètres DNS:

Racine - <domain>.net

Nameserver: 1 & 1 Nameserver (par défaut) A/AAAA Entry (adresse IP): 1 & 1 IP-Address (par défaut)

Sous-domaine - www.<domain>.net

Paramètres DNS: CNAME - Alias: <appname>.herokuapp.com

3
user53213

La cible <appname> .herokuapp.com effectue virtualhosting (hébergement de plusieurs domaines sur une même adresse IP) et votre espace est configuré pour répondre aux demandes de <appname> .herokuapp.com mais puisque vous avez fait un CNAME de www. <domaine> .net pointant dessus, la cible reçoit une requête pour www. <domaine> .net et à moins que la cible est spécifiquement configuré pour faire quelque chose pour ce nom d’hôte, il ne fonctionnera pas comme prévu.

2
multia